Learning Lab: Aggregation – Squeezing the Most Value Out of Your RCAs and FMEAs

As quality professionals, we understand the importance of “sample size” – the more samples we have the better our data and decision-making is. Unfortunately, some of our most important data that deals with some of the most significant risks to the organization has the smallest sample size. Yes, we are talking about our root cause analyses (RCAs) and our failure mode and effects analyses (FMEAs) – both key analyses that help our leadership deal with their most pressing challenges. So what to do? The key is to move beyond looking at each RCA and FMEA individually. It is difficult to make a compelling case to leadership with just one data point. If we want to really squeeze as much decision support value out of these analyses as we can, we need to aggregate, aggregate, aggregate!

In this Learning Lab, we will discuss how to Aggregate your RCAs and FMEAs starting with some simple coding and analysis to open up our understanding of the organizational issues that may be even bigger than those identified in the individual RCAs and FMEAs.
